gpt4 book ai didi

mysql - 错误 1064 (42000) : errror near ' PRIMARY KEY

转载 作者:行者123 更新时间:2023-11-29 09:50:31 25 4
gpt4 key购买 nike

我的sql脚本如下:

CREATE database `stock`;
USE `stock`;
CREATE TABLE `stock_all` (
`state_dt` varchar(45),
`stock_code` varchar(45),
`open` decimal(20,2),
UNIQUE INDEX `stock_code`,
PRIMARY KEY `state_dt`);

在mysql命令行中source它,出现错误信息。

ERROR 1064 (42000): You have an error in your SQL syntax; check the manual that corresponds to your MariaDB server version for the right syntax to use near '
PRIMARY KEY `state_dt`)' at line 5

如何修复我的 sql 脚本?

最佳答案

您需要按照手册添加括号:

CREATE TABLE `stock_all` (
`state_dt` varchar(45),
`stock_code` varchar(45),
`open` decimal(20,2),
UNIQUE INDEX (`stock_code`),
PRIMARY KEY (`state_dt`)
);

关于mysql - 错误 1064 (42000) : errror near ' PRIMARY KEY,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/54897331/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com